In this intimate exhibition, acclaimed portrait photographer Robert Kalman invites viewers to look closely into the faces, stories, and personal truths of individuals from across the United States. Through his signature style of honest, beautifully composed portraiture, Kalman captures how people see themselves within the ever-evolving American experience.

Each portrait is paired with a handwritten reflection, offering an unfiltered glimpse into the hopes, struggles, and perspectives that shape life in this country today. Together, these voices and images form a powerful mosaic that defines the American identity in this milestone year celebrating the 250th anniversary of the signing of the Declaration of Independence.

Author Talk & Book Signing: Photographer Robert Kalman

What does it mean to be an American? Photographer Robert Kalman spent four years and 20,000 miles capturing nearly 500 Americans in large-format portraits, paired with their handwritten reflections. He and his wife Linda share their journey, demonstrate his large view camera process, and explore the stories behind his collection What's it Like for You to be an American?
